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4981 542451 7679096699
1491600964 2198205962 9041391656
1491600964 2198205962 9041391656
56 43 82109423
All about undefined
Interested in learning more?
1491600964 2198205962 9041391656
56 43 82109423
See more
3205012816 3315
76744 0589996168 8696068 6546280
See more
7682 222 306734725
0706 5865 4180
See more